Technical Field
The utility model relates to the technical field of vehicle-mounted refrigeration, in particular to a refrigerating device and a refrigerating system of a vehicle-mounted refrigerator.
Background
The vehicle-mounted refrigerator is a refrigerated cabinet which can be carried on an automobile, and the vehicle-mounted refrigerator is a new generation of refrigeration and cold storage appliance popular in the international market in recent years.
The throttling and flow control of the existing vehicle-mounted refrigerator are realized by throttling and depressurizing by utilizing a capillary tube assembly, only the control of constant flow can be met, and the evaporation temperature under different environmental temperatures cannot be automatically adjusted.

Referring to fig. 1, the present invention provides a refrigeration device for a vehicle-mounted refrigerator, the refrigeration device for a vehicle-mounted refrigerator comprises a compressor 1, a condenser 2, an electronic expansion valve 3, an evaporator 4, a liquid storage device 5, a first temperature sensing head 6 and a second temperature sensing head 7, the condenser 2 is connected to the compressor 1 through a pipeline, and is positioned at one side of the compressor 1, the evaporator 4 is connected with the condenser 2 through a pipeline, and is positioned at one side of the condenser 2, the liquid storage device 5 is respectively connected with the evaporator 4 and the compressor 1 through pipelines, and is positioned between the evaporator 4 and the compressor 1, the electronic expansion valve 3 is disposed between the evaporator 4 and the condenser 2, the first temperature sensing head 6 is arranged at the outer side of the vehicle-mounted refrigerator, the second temperature sensing head 7 is arranged at the outlet of the evaporator 4, the first temperature sensing head 6 and the second temperature sensing head 7 are both electrically connected with the electronic expansion valve 3.
In the present embodiment, the compressor 1 converts low-pressure gas into high-pressure gas, and sends the high-pressure gas to the condenser 2, the condenser 2 converts the gas into liquid refrigerant and sends the liquid refrigerant to the evaporator 4, the liquid in the evaporator 4 absorbs heat to form gas, and returns to the compressor 1, thereby completing the refrigeration cycle, detecting the external environment temperature of the vehicle-mounted refrigerator through the first temperature sensing head 6, detecting the outlet temperature of the evaporator 4 through the temperature monitoring of the second temperature sensing head 7, thereby controlling the opening and closing degree of the electronic expansion valve 3 to adjust the flow rate and pressure ratio, when the temperature rises and the superheat degree increases, and a series of flow-variable systematic adjustments such as increasing the flow rate, increasing the evaporation pressure, increasing the evaporation temperature, reducing the exhaust pressure, and reducing the motor load of the compressor 1 are performed to meet the requirement of higher refrigerating capacity in a high-temperature state.
Further, the refrigerating device of the vehicle-mounted refrigerator further comprises a dry filter 8, and the dry filter 8 is arranged between the condenser 2 and the electronic expansion valve 3; the refrigerating device of the vehicle-mounted refrigerator further comprises a condensing fan 9, wherein the condensing fan 9 is fixedly connected with the condenser 2 and is positioned at the heat dissipation end of the condenser 2.
In the present embodiment, impurities in the refrigerant are filtered by the dry filter 8; the condensing fan 9 assists the condenser 2 in dissipating heat, and the service life of the equipment is prolonged.
Referring to fig. 2, the present invention further provides a vehicle-mounted refrigerator refrigeration system, including the vehicle-mounted refrigerator refrigeration apparatus, further including an electronic control regulator 10, where the electronic control regulator 10 is electrically connected to the first temperature sensing head 6, the second temperature sensing head 7, and the electronic expansion valve 3, respectively; the refrigerating system of the refrigerator also comprises a refrigerating cup stand 11, wherein the refrigerating cup stand 11 is connected with the evaporator 4 through a pipeline and is arranged in the refrigerating refrigerator.
In the present embodiment, the opening degree of the electronic expansion valve 3 is controlled by the electronic control regulator 10, thereby adjusting the flow rate-to-pressure ratio; a water cup or a water bottle is placed in the refrigeration cup stand 11, so that the refrigeration speed is improved.
Further, the refrigeration cup holder 11 includes a fixing plate 111, an aluminum cup holder 112 and an annular evaporation tube 113, the fixing plate 111 is fixedly connected with the vehicle-mounted refrigerator and is located inside the vehicle-mounted refrigerator, the aluminum cup holder 112 is fixedly connected with the fixing plate 111 and is located inside the fixing plate 111, and the annular evaporation tube 113 is communicated with the evaporator 4 and is wound on the outer side wall of the aluminum cup holder 112.
In the present embodiment, the contact area with the aluminum cup holder 112 is increased by the annular evaporation tube 113, and the aluminum cup holder 112 is cooled by the principle of heat absorption by liquid evaporation, thereby cooling an object placed in the aluminum cup holder 112.
Further, the refrigerating cup holder 11 further includes a foaming insulation layer 114, and the foaming insulation layer 114 is fixedly connected to the fixing plate 111 and is located above the fixing plate 111.
In the present embodiment, the foamed insulation layer 114 reduces temperature exchange between the in-vehicle refrigerator and the outside, thereby maintaining a low temperature environment inside the in-vehicle refrigerator.
